West Medinipur: Doctor beaten for refusing to see the disease, Trinamool leader termed the allegations baseless

West Bengal: Trinamool’s Karnagarh zone president Kanchan Chakraborty has been accused of beating up a doctor in Shalbani, West Medinipur for refusing to go home to see the patient. A complaint has been lodged in the police station in this regard. The accused Trinamool leader has claimed that this complaint is being made for political purposes. On the other hand, BJP has taken a dig at the ruling party of the state.

Brutally beaten inside the chamber! Accused of dragging him by the collar to the patient’s home. Later, protest was held by placing the dead patient’s body in front of the doctor’s house. The zonal president of Trinamool has been accused of punishing a doctor in this way for not going to see the sick relative of a Trinamool leader. The victim, Dr Nikhilranjan Ghosh, said, “In an intoxicated state, he grabbed my collar, beat me and dragged me.”

Trinamool leader accused of being drunk

This incident took place in Bhadutala area of ​​Shalbani block of West Medinipur. According to local sources, a relative of Trinamool’s Karnagarh zone president Kanchan Chakraborty was ill. A relative of the Trinamool leader went to his chamber to call local homeopathy doctor Nikhilranjan Ghosh on Monday morning. The doctor claims that the Trinamool leader reached there in an inebriated state after refusing to go home due to illness. Along with beating him, he was also dragged.

Doctor vs Politician: Allegation-Counter-allegation Controversy

Regarding the incident, Nikhilranjan Ghosh said, I told him, you know, I have not come out of the chamber since Covid. My health is also very bad. I have completely stopped seeing patients outside. The Trinamool leader there, Kanchan Chakraborty, came in an intoxicated state and grabbed me by the collar and beat me.

The accused Trinamool leader claims that the doctor’s claim is baseless and politically motivated. Kanchan Chakraborty said, there was no fight. We went to call him four times, but he did not come. Then I went. I did not slap anyone. He was my father’s friend. Can I kill them? Absolutely false. That’s what BJP does.

Protest by keeping dead body in front of doctor’s house

The doctor claims that when he went there he found that the patient had already died. Despite this, a protest was held by placing the dead body in front of his house. The doctor was taken to Medinipur Medical College Hospital after he felt unwell at night due to the incident. He was discharged after first aid. Political allegations and counter-allegations have started regarding the incident.
